About Us
Atain is an admitted and non-admitted property and casualty insurance company dedicated to serving niche programs and excess & surplus (E&S) markets. Licensed in 50 states, Atain underwrites numerous lines of business including professional liability, general liability, and commercial multi-peril risks. This structure provides maximum flexibility in responding to business opportunities as they arise. We pride ourselves on delivering exceptional service and innovative products to our clients. As part of our commitment to excellence, we are seeking a dynamic and experienced individual to join our team as a Senior Property Underwriter.
Role Overview
As a Contract Bind Underwriter, you will play a critical role in driving the growth and profitability of our Contract Binding Division. You will be responsible for marketing our Property, Casualty and Inland Marine products to an exclusive wholesale broker, building and maintaining strong relationships, and underwriting risks in accordance with company guidelines and standards.
Responsibilities
- Develop and execute marketing strategies to promote our products to an exclusive wholesale broker.
- Build and nurture relationships with key stakeholders, including brokers, agents, and internal teams, to drive business growth and retention.
- Evaluate and underwrite P&C risks, ensuring adherence to underwriting guidelines, policies, and procedures.
- Analyze and interpret data to determine risks and potential exposures.
- Analyze market trends, competitive landscape, and emerging risks to identify opportunities for product enhancement and innovation.
- Collaborate with the underwriting team to assess and price risks effectively while maintaining profitability targets.
- Provide exceptional customer service by responding to inquiries, resolving issues, and delivering timely underwriting decisions.
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, Insurance, or related field.
- 2-8 years of experience in the Excess & Surplus Lines Insurance Industry
- Strong knowledge of insurance principles, underwriting practices, and industry regulations.
- Proven track record of building and managing relationships with brokers and agents.
- Excellent analytical, negotiation, and decision-making skills.
- Ability to travel: 10 – 15%
-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- Effective communication and presentation skills, with the ability to influence and persuade stakeholders.
